Passage 1

Most people agree that taxes must be paid. Government couldn’t run without money. But people argue about how taxes should be collected.Now the government works with a “progressive tax”. Not everyone pays the same percentage of his salary in taxes. Poor people are in a low tax bracket. They pay the smallest percentage of income in taxes. Middle-income workers pay a larger percentage than the poor. And the rich fall into the high tax brackets. Few rich people like the progressive tax.The government took a poll. Among other people, the government talked to Ray Mathers and Eve Winick. “Let’s change to a flat rate tax,” Says Ray Mathers. “Everyone should be taxed the same percentage. It’s fair. And it’s easy to figure out.” Mathers is president of Trig Computer Company. He makes over $80,000 a year. “I don’ t want a flat rate income tax,” says Eve Winick. Winick is a grammar school teacher. Her school is in a poor neighborhood. She makes $14,000 a year. “I don’t care if it’s easier to figure out. What I want to know is, would I pay less tax?” Winick worries about her students’ parents. “Some of them can hardly support themselves. Why should they pay heavier taxes? They’re the people who need government services.”Mathers thinks a flat rate would help in the long run. “The country could lower taxes after a while. See, if I paid fewer taxes, I’d save money. I’d put that money into my business and hire more people. Those people could pay taxes. Everybody would be better off.”

    (71) [Even as exchanges emerge to enable rich interaction among companies, businesses are looking to the Internet to enable the adoption of truly dynamic pricing.] One solution is emerging in the form. of bots, software that serves as an agent acting on behalf of a specific user or application. Advancing bot technology enables dynamic, automated, real-time interaction between buyers and sellers, allowing sellers to capture the true value of their goods in the market. (72) [The implications for businesses are vital, since this emerging technology may change how companies sell their goods.] Ramifications companies need to take steps to address include: 

    ●Disintermediation of individual auction environments through bots that allow buyers to automatically poll multiple auction services and fixed-price channels to garner advantageous terms; 

    ●(73) [Development of exchanges that aggregate the information harvested by bots in order to reduce transaction costs and eliminate concerns of fraud;] and 

    ●(74) [The emergence of the bot-aggregator exchange as a primary sales channel, which employs rules to enable transactions.]

    ●(75) [The bot future is not yet certain. For example, providers must find ways to reduce per-transaction costs before widespread adoption can occur.] But the powerful connectivity of the Internet is rapidly evolving the buyer/seller relationship. With bot technology advancing quickly, companies should prepare for a future priced for demand.
